DAVID ALACEY IS FRANK SINATRA David trained at The Italia Conti Academy in London as an actor and has appeared since then in various theatre and television productions. However, he is best known for his remarkably accurate tribute to Frank Sinatra which has taken him all over the world and led to television appearances such as "Look East", "Barrymore", and "London Tonight". He can also be heard as Sinatra on various TV and radio advertising campaigns. During a performance at the Cafe Royal, former Rat Pack member and Vegas legend Buddy Greco said of David, " This guy really is Sinatra" now that is a complement! RAHUL IS SAMMY DAVIS JNR Rahul was immediately signed to David Alacey Productions after David heard his outstanding performance of Sammy's classic 'Mr Bojangles'. This proved to be an extremely good decision, as the similarities between Sammy and Rahul are not limited to singing. Both share South American parentage and both were influenced by the the drumming skills of Buddy Rich. Yes Rahul, like his hero Sammy, is a man of many talents, one of these, song writing, led to a recording contract with Time Records and a number of top ten hits in countries such as India. His favourite part of the Rat Pack show is his duet with David on 'Me and My Shadow', this guy's got style too! HARRY IS DEAN MARTIN Having worked for many years on the British club circuit, it was not until Harry was asked to sing a song at a private function held in the legendary Ceasers Palace Ballroom, Las Vegas, that he realized his next career step would be the formation of a tribute show to Dean Martin. Since then he has appeared at major venues worldwide as part of 'The Rat Pack Is Back' and was recently heard singing 'Ain't That A Kick In The Head' for an international advertising campaign.
